每天一个C++小程序(十五)--快速排序
来源:互联网 发布:如何导入sql数据库 编辑:程序博客网 时间:2024/05/17 01:40
//快速排序void QucikSort(int a[],int low,int high){ int i=low,j=high,x=a[low],t; do{ while (a[j]>x && j>low)j--; while (a[i]<x && i<high)i++; if (i<=j){ t=a[i]; a[i]=a[j]; a[j]=t; i++; j--; } }while (i<=j); if (low<j)QucikSort(a,low,j); if (high>i)QucikSort(a,i,high);}
—————————————————————————————————
本文原创自Slience的csdn技术博客。
本博客所有原创文章请以链接形式注明出处。
欢迎关注本技术博客,本博客的文章会不定期更新。
大多数人想要改造这个世界,但却罕有人想改造自己。
世上没有绝望的处境,只有对处境绝望的人。
————By slience
—————————————————————————————————
0 0
- 每天一个C++小程序(十五)--快速排序
- 每天一个c++小程序(1):快速排序
- 每天一个小程序(15)——交换排序之快速排序
- 每天一个小程序(16)——交换排序之快速排序2
- 每天一个C++小程序(十四)--堆排序
- 每天一个C++小程序(十八)--插入排序
- 每天一个C++小程序(十九)--桶排序
- 每天一个小程序(12)——交换排序之冒泡排序
- 每天一个小程序(14)——交换排序之双向冒泡排序
- 每天一个小程序(19)——选择排序
- java入门#每天一个小程序#插入排序
- 每天一个java小程序之冒泡排序
- 每天一个C程序
- 每天一个小程序(10)——直接插入排序
- 每天一个小程序(11)——折半插入排序
- 每天一个小算法 --- 排序
- 每天一个java小程序
- 每天一个java小程序
- 美强调无反华意图 帮助中国在亚太有一席之地
- Java学习第一站(2)
- Java Card CAP 文件组件分析 00
- Android检测版本更新(读取apk配置文件中的版本信息)
- nefu 628 Garden visiting
- 每天一个C++小程序(十五)--快速排序
- 关于抱怨解读,读书笔记
- 第九周项目一
- 杭电1856More is better(并查集)
- BFS(模板)
- C++:private继承与public继承
- C++ struct与class的区别
- java停止线程 interrupt 和守护线程setDaemon
- Java Card CAP 文件组件分析 09—— Reference Location Component